When Abigail was about 18 months old, it was discovered that her spine did not form properly....(I like to call it a puzzle spine) she has three vertabrae that did not separate on one side and a couple of vertabrae that are shaped like triangles instead of rectangles. Because of the deformities, her spine began to rotate and curve and she was diagnosed with congenital scoliosis (with thoracic insufficiency).

Like anyone else would, we searched high and low for the best treatment for her and came to the conclusion that a Vertical Expandable Titanium Prosthetic Rib was our best option. A VEPTR is normally attached to the child's spine and rib and allows the rib to expand. It has to be expanded (or replaced) every five or six months until the patient is done growng. In Abigail's case, her curve was so severe that one lung had only grown to 75% of the other one, thus diminishing her capacity to breathe. She had her first surgery in January, 2008 when she was 4 years old. Surgery #9 was two weeks ago.
